ill1_67x67_tcm18-18753.jpgOver the course of a career the role of Clinical Scientist will include opportunities for laboratory work, basic and applied research, management and teaching. In addition there is the added advantage of contributing directly to patient treatment and care.The basic vocational training of Clinical Scientists prepares you for a wide variety of roles ranging from Audiology and Biochemistry to Microbiology and Clinical Cytogenetics. Whilst not every Clinical Scientist will want to work in every field, each will receive appropriate vocational training to be able to fulfil the roles most characteristic of a scientist in innovation, experimentation and evaluation of the applications of scientific developments to health care and patient wellbeing.
